A grain-size analyzer with settling tube system was established.A personal computer controls this system and process data.
We measured the grain-size distribution of same samples by three kinds of measuring method; the sieving method,sedimentation method with Emery tube,and sedimentation method with this analyzer.Samples are standard glass spheres(0.177-0.250mm)and beach sand.Analyzing grain size distribution is the moment method.No significant difference among three measuring methods recognized on standard glass spheres.However,the arithmetric mean of beach sand given by this analyzer is approximately 0.4 phi,which is finer than that by the other methods.On sieving method,platy particle may readily pass diagonally through mesh.The other hand,concentrated sample may accelerate settling velocity in Emery tube.Thus size determination by these two methods is coarser.The analyzer in the present study is less susceptible to these factors.Further,this analyzer has high possibilities to connect with the hydrometer technique,and its measurement time is short in comparison with the other methods. |
